Tinubu Hosts Ibori, Okoya, Bagudu in Lagos.


President Bola Tinubu hosted several prominent figures at his Lagos residence on Saturday. Among the visitors were former Delta State Governor James Ibori, Minister of

Budget and Economic Planning Abubakar Bagudu, and industrialist Razak Okoya, who attended with his wife, Shade, and their son.

The president has been in Lagos since May 27, participating in the 50th anniversary celebration of the Economic Community of West African States (ECOWAS) and commissioning multiple development projects.

Tinubu is expected to return to the Federal Capital Territory after the Eid-el-Kabir holiday.

In his Eid message, the president encouraged Nigerians to pray for peace and unity in the country. He acknowledged the challenges citizens have faced over the past year and reaffirmed his administration’s commitment to improving the nation’s security, economy, and overall well-being.
